Calusa Ridge breaks ground for model home

x
Holding seven reservations for homes, Calusa Ridge, Pine Island’s new nature preserve community, broke ground last week for a model home.
“We are very excited about the response we are receiving for this project,” said Calusa Ridge manager Roger Schutt. “We currently have several properties under contract with a few pending at this point. What is just as exciting is that not only do we have property owners from Germany, Michigan, New Jersey and Ohio, but we also are finding a great deal of interest in those who already live here locally.”
The first home on the property, the Boca Grande, is a Florida design, three-bedroom, two-bath single family home with large front and rear porches, a swimming pool and an oversized, side load garage.
“Some of the nice features of this home are the 20- inch tiles that will be used in the great room area and all of the counter tops will be granite,” Schutt said. “I think people will really enjoy the open floor plan and we are doing our best to disturb the native vegetation as little as possible to maintain the nature preserve of the area.”
Calusa Ridge is a 60-acre gated community located on Stringfellow Road in Bokeelia. The property features ample open spaces with native vegetation, a six-acre lake and all the the utilities will be installed underground. Home sites range in price from $39,900 to $59,900 and the preferred builder, SWFL Homes is offering several floor plans ranging from 1,600 square feet and up with pricing starting at $179,900.
